No traffic road cycling routes around Thignonville are primarily characterized by the flat, cultivated fields of the Beauce region, offering extensive routes with minimal elevation changes. The area is part of the Loiret department, which features diverse natural environments including agricultural plains and proximity to the Loire River. This landscape provides ideal conditions for road cycling on quiet country roads.

The Château de Courcelles-le-Roi is discreet behind its high walls and hedges, and yet it has left its mark on the history of France, welcoming within its walls some of the most illustrious kings. A former fortified castle whose construction dates back to the 11th century, it was destroyed and rebuilt three times, including twice during the Hundred Years' War. Located on the lands of the Orléans forest where the kings came to hunt, Saint-Louis and Charles VIII stayed there. Anne of Brittany, Queen of France and wife of Charles VIII, gave birth there to a baby, François, who unfortunately only lived a few hours. Guided tours are organized there.

The Manoir de la Taille, also known as the Château de Bondaroy, is a fortified manor house which dates from the 14th century and was the birthplace of two Renaissance poets, Jean and Jacques de La Taille. You can admire the impressive facade, towers and gatehouse, as well as the surrounding countryside. You can also explore the neighboring town of Pithiviers, which has a rich heritage and a famous pastry, the pithivier.

The Manor of La Taille, also called Château de Bondaroy, is a fortified manor whose construction dates back to the 14th century. Opulent construction, it does not leave indifferent the walkers who follow its thick walls. Listed in the register of historical monuments in 1974, the manor is now a private property. Banquets and seminars are sometimes organized there and it is possible to visit the place during the summer.

Pithiviers is a commune located in the heart of Beauce, in the hollow of the Egg. In a very rural Beauce, Pithiviers is a historical and cultural lung. The Château de Bellecour, the Saint-Georges collegiate church, the town hall or the Place du Martroi are just a few examples of the many curiosities that swarm the city. With 9,000 inhabitants, the city has all types of shops, from accommodation to restaurants. Wander the alleys of its old center to find a pretty table or a comfortable mattress. The Pithiviers train station is now closed to the public, but buses from the Ulys network serve daily Orléans (line 20) and Montargis (line 11) where a train station allows travel to Paris.

What kind of landscapes can I expect to see on traffic-free road bike routes near Thignonville?

The routes primarily traverse the vast, cultivated fields of the Beauce region, often referred to as France's 'breadbasket,' offering long, scenic rides with minimal elevation changes. You'll experience open agricultural landscapes, quiet country roads, and the peaceful ambiance of rural France. The wider Loiret department also features forests and the picturesque banks of the Loire River, providing diverse scenery.

Are there any cultural or historical sites accessible from these routes?

While Thignonville itself is a quiet agricultural commune, its strategic location in the Loiret department means you're within reach of notable attractions. Cyclists can combine their rides with visits to charming villages like Yèvre-le-Châtel (18 km away), known for its traditional charm and ruined castle. Larger towns like Pithiviers (13 km) also offer cultural and architectural heritage. The region is also dotted with châteaux, such as Château de Chamerolles (24 km).

What amenities are available for cyclists in the Thignonville area?

The Loiret department is very bike-friendly, with many local businesses and services holding the 'Accueil Vélo' (cycle-friendly) label. This means you can find accommodations, rental services, and repair facilities that cater specifically to cyclists. While Thignonville is small, nearby towns like Pithiviers offer more amenities, including cafes and shops, which can be incorporated into your cycling plans.
